Operations Without Pain: The Practice and Science of Anaesthesia in Victorian Britain

The introduction of anaesthesia to Victorian Britain marked a defining moment between modern medicine and earlier practices. This book uses new information from John Snow's casebooks and London hospital archives to revise many of the existing historical assumptions about the early history of su...
